How they compare
Iraq currently reports 104.57 against 104.53 in Uruguay, a difference of 0.04.
The two have swapped places 4 times across 37 shared years of data; in 1971 it was Uruguay ahead.
Iraq ranks 69th and Uruguay ranks 70th of 217 countries.
Uruguay has averaged higher in every one of the 4 decades both report.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Iraq | Uruguay |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1970s | 81.4 | 108.66 | 27.27 | Uruguay |
| 1980s | 102.68 | 109.85 | 7.17 | Uruguay |
| 1990s | 92.49 | 112.01 | 19.52 | Uruguay |
| 2000s | 96.65 | 110.87 | 14.22 | Uruguay |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.

About this data
Primary secondary enrollment completion rates with 569 missing years estimated by linear interpolation between the nearest real observations. Only gaps of 4 years or fewer are filled, and never beyond the first or last actual measurement — these are filled holes, not forecasts.
